Detriti Split 3

La Punta Bianca is a minimal synth duo with lyrics in French and Italian from Paris, France.

Kuzina (meaning “cousin”) – founded in 2018 in Voronezh, Russia, stands at the intersection of synth-pop, new wave and minimal synth. Their synths sound like they’ve been dragged through the dirt and played through slashed speakers, and the vocals resemble Soviet female singers from the 80s.

Reymour - Leviosa

Reymour is a minimal synth duo from Brussels, Belgium, described as a “psycho-romantic adventure, strewn and dotted with 80′s sounds and bucolic texts for alcoholics”.
